Output 8c904c054980226ef071c6fa698b438f6afc0a55fe7a3d51e50f69a016df770c:1

value
143194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c037fe0834125187756f680e9216c519e4cd7562 OP_EQUAL
address
3KDNjnjQ9UCRv7St7KP7hAdpMTQfoDvX4A
transaction
8c904c054980226ef071c6fa698b438f6afc0a55fe7a3d51e50f69a016df770c
spent
true